Learning About copyright Side Consequences: A Comprehensive Guide

copyright, a widely used medication for controlling blood sugar , can produce a range of unwanted consequences. While many people tolerate copyright without issue, it's crucial to understand potential issues. These might encompass minor symptoms like sickness , vomiting , bowel issues, and infrequent bowel movements. More concerning dangers such as pancreatitis , bile duct issues , and dangerously low glucose can occur , even though they are rare . GLP-1 Medications: How copyright Fits In

GLP-1 drugs represent a innovative class of doctor-prescribed treatments initially developed for treating diabetes type 2 but now also employed for weight loss . copyright is a prominent example of a GLP-1 drug, specifically designed to replicate the body's natural GLP-1 substance , helping to improve blood sugar and promote fullness , which can contribute to a decrease in weight. Keep in mind that this medication is typically prescribed under the supervision of a physician and isn't appropriate for everybody.

Understanding copyright: Frequently Seen Problems & How to Manage Them

Like most treatment, copyright might result in certain reactions. Often experienced concerns feature nausea, constipation, being sick, loose stools, or headache. To reduce these kind of discomforts, consider initially with a lower dose & slowly boosting it when told from your doctor. Furthermore, keeping adequately hydrated through taking in plenty water plus taking a meal rich in plant matter might assist at bowel issues. If your signs become intense or continue, it is important to see your doctor immediately.
